On average, 3-star hotels in Phnom Penh cost $68 per night, and 4-star hotels in Phnom Penh are $157 per night. If you're looking for something really special, a 5-star hotel in Phnom Penh can be found for $339 per night, on average (based on Booking.com prices).
The average price per night for a 3-star hotel in Phnom Penh this weekend is $38 or, for a 4-star hotel, $74. Looking for something even fancier? 5-star hotels in Phnom Penh for this weekend cost around $226 per night, on average (based on Booking.com prices).

Everyone will seem friendly at first, then try to sell you something if you engage in conversation. The food is incredible, the sights are beautiful, and it is a great time just walking around or grabbing a cheap tuktuk on Grab to head to the temples. But be prepared to constantly have to fend off guys trying to sell you stuff or asking for cash when you're on your own walking about. Not a big deal at all, just something to be aware of.
Very easy to get around with Tuk Tuk. I’m impressed with all the people we met, the English was very good so communicating was easy. We stayed at Plantation Urban resort and loved the ambiance. Great way to wind down after a busy day in the city. Killing fields and the prison is a must when in Phnom Penh, but what I felt was underrated was the Phnom Tamao Wildlife rescue center. We spent half day there and loved it. For cocktail and views, eclipse sky bar is a gem and for LGBTQ+ people and alleys, space hair salon and bar is the best gay bar. The concept is so cool. In daytime it is a hair salon and in the evening, the salon is transferred to a bar. They have different themes everyday and the community felt like home. Everyone so friendly and fun!! Definitely worth a night there!!
Beautiful city with a lot of history. Unfortunately, the National Palace and the Silver Pagoda are still closed, but there are many museums and activities to do around. There are many tours that might work as well. Tuol Seng Museum, even though is rough, is definitely a must.

Phnom Penh can be used as a hub to travel across Cambodia being the center of the country and also for relaxation however the Palace was closed which was a pity as there are not much of excursion choices the city has. The people here are simple folk however due to commercialisation only money matters and if there is no value transaction in monetary terms then the common answer you would get is "I don't know". It is advisable to use a good net on the mobile and have Grab & Passapp on the mobile otherwise would be charged 4 times of the tuk tuk or taxi charges. One can go around the market and try the local and the French Restaurants which are in plenty. To stay in the center of the city otherwise the cost of travel will hit the wallet big time.
